Ticket VLT-providing: Wiki vault locked after role sync. The Brindlewiki role-based access job ran twice last night and revoked editor rights on the Release space, then auto-locked the credentials vault as a precaution. Release notes for 4.2 are inside it. Page permissions are restored; only the vault remains sealed. Per policy, the release manager may unseal it directly using the recovery passphrase recorded immediately below this ticket body.

vault phrase of bagaf-kajeg = jorath-feniel-briir-siliel-ralix

This section of the Fennelgate gateway design covers websocket compression. Per-message deflate reduces bandwidth by roughly 60% on our chat payloads, but context takeover inflates memory per connection, which matters at our concurrency targets. We chose a shared-window strategy with conservative sizing, trading some compression ratio for predictable memory. Future maintainers should revisit these values if payload shapes change materially. The agreed tuning constants are listed below.

tuning table, kajog-kawef:
PRIORITIES = {
    "kelox": 870,
    "kasix": 89,
    "eliax": 988,
}

## Break-Glass: WaveGlance Preview Service

Hey reviewers — if WaveGlance's audio waveform preview renderer goes down and the normal deploy path is frozen, break-glass access lets you push a hotfix directly. Use it sparingly and note it in the review thread afterward. The emergency account unlocks with the passphrase right below.

vault phrase of hahop-badug = novvan-ulaion-zorius-noviel-gorwyn-casix-tamys

A: `plumbtail` merges streams from each shard of the Ferrowick log store and deduplicates by sequence number. During shard rebalancing, sequence numbers can briefly overlap, so duplicates appear for up to a minute. This is expected and safe; the CLI prints a rebalance warning when it happens. If duplicates persist longer, the shard map cache is likely stale — clear it with `plumbtail cache flush`. Known failure modes and cache internals are documented on the internal page.

dashboard of bafof-hafog = https://confluence.lumiclabs.internal/display/browse/display/6a09a20a